Chennai, Oct 26 (UNI) "Elecrama-2008", the world's largest trade fair for power sector, will be held in Mumbai from January 18 to 22 next year.

The biggest electrical and electronics industries exhibition of Asia, Africa and the Middle East would be organised by the Indian Electrical and Electronics Manufacturers' Association (IEEMA) with the theme "The future of power is here".

Talking to newspersons here today, Elecrama Chairman Vimal Mahendru and IEEMA Director General Sunil More said this B2B fair would provide an ideal platform for Indian and foreign companies to showcase their products that could cater to power generating capacity demands.

The exhibition would address issues like innovative energy technologies as well as equal integration of renewable and conventional energy sources.

It would have international seminars on switchgear industry, cables and wires industry and rotating machines industry.

More than 1,000 companies, including 150 firms from 40 countries, would participate in the fair.

There would be biggest participation from Germany, China, Korea, Taiwan, Sri Lanka and Italy.

''We are expecting about 1,00,000 visitors during the five-day event'', Mr More said.
